About Real Estate Due Diligence Law in Makurdi, Nigeria

Due diligence in real estate refers to the process of researching and analyzing information about a property as part of a real estate transaction. In Makurdi, Nigeria, this process often includes investigating the validity of the property title, physical inspection of the property, examination of regulatory issues, and assessment of any potential liabilities. The due diligence process helps potential buyers to avoid legal complications, financial losses, and other potential pitfalls.

Local Laws Overview

In Makurdi, Nigeria, real estate laws can be complex but some key aspects pertain to land use regulations, property rights, and transactional procedures. It is required by law to obtain a Certificate of Occupancy for most types of land transactions. Transfer of property rights is governed by the Land Use Act. Also, fiduciary responsibilities are imposed on agents representing buyers or sellers. Given the complexity of local real estate laws, the assistance of a professional lawyer can be of immense value.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a Certificate of Occupancy?

A Certificate of Occupancy is a document issued by a local government agency or building department certifying a building's compliance with applicable building codes and other laws.

Why is due diligence important in real estate transactions?

Due diligence helps to identify potential risks, liabilities, and problems related to the property, and hence, is crucial in making informed investment decisions.

What kind of information is usually investigated during the due diligence process?

Common areas of investigation include property title, planning and zoning, environmental issues, physical condition of the property, and financial considerations.
